Are you familiar with "Secrets of the Saqqara Tomb" on Netflix? These cat mummies and statues were discovered at the same site.
Quote from the article:
And while cat mummies are fascinating, Catanzariti said they were also pretty common in ancient Egypt, where cats were bred for the purpose. In the 1890s, people from England went to Egypt and they collected all these mummies. One cargo was 180,000 of them.
Comments